You said my floor is 'dry to the touch,' but your meter says it's not. Why isn't 'dry to the touch' actually dry?

'Dry to the touch' is a surface condition, not a structural standard. In Claysburg Center's climate, we adhere to the IICRC S500 psychrometric dry standard of 40 Grains Per Pound (GPP) at 70°F. This measures the vapor pressure and actual moisture content within materials. Achieving this standard prevents residual moisture from migrating and causing secondary damage, which is the required protocol for a complete restoration.

How quickly does mold become a problem after a water leak?

The established window for microbial growth initiation is 48-72 hours after a water intrusion. Beginning mitigation within this window is the industry Standard of Care. As of 2026, documentation proving a response within this timeframe is critical for insurance compliance. Delays beyond this window shift liability and typically necessitate formal mold remediation protocols, which are a separate and more complex claim.

What should I do the second I discover a major water leak?

Your first action is to stop the water source. Locate and operate the main water shut-off valve. This immediate step is the most critical for mitigating 'loss of use' and limiting damage. Then, contact your utility provider for emergency service if needed.
